State Route 25 (SR 25) is an Ohio state route that runs between Cygnet and Toledo in the US state of Ohio.The highway has a total length of 34.98 miles (56.29 km). Some of the highway is listed on the National Highway System and various sections are rural four-lane highways and urbanized four-lane divided highways.
